SDIBE_MASSFIELDS is a standard SAP Structure so does not store data like a database table does. It can be used to define the fields of other actual tables or to process "MRP Area Selection Fields for Mass Data Maintenance" Information within sap ABAP programs.
This is done by declaring abap internal tables, work areas or database tables based on this Structure. These can then be used to store and process the required data appropriately.
i.e. DATA: wa_SDIBE_MASSFIELDS TYPE SDIBE_MASSFIELDS.
The SDIBE_MASSFIELDS table consists of various fields, each holding specific information or linking keys about MRP Area Selection Fields for Mass Data Maintenance data available in SAP. These include XDISMM (Checkbox), XDISPO (Checkbox), XDISGR (Checkbox), XMINBE (Checkbox).. How do I retrieve data from SAP structure SDIBE_MASSFIELDS using ABAP code?
As SDIBE_MASSFIELDS is a database structure and not a table it does not store any data in the SAP data dictionary. The ABAP SELECT statement is therefore not appropriate and can not be performed on SDIBE_MASSFIELDS as there is no data to select.How to access SAP table SDIBE_MASSFIELDS
